Radek Štencl (born 1977) is a Czech contemporary painter who openly calls himself a “voracious observer”. He refers to his desire to absorb as many layers of life as possible. His works depict objects in their many layers, which the line connects in time and space.

Fulfilled dreams (Grossglockner)

100 × 150 cm
Acrylic on canvas
Radek Štencl, 2022

13th painting from the Fluid lines series.

Being born in part of Czechia not far away from beautiful and famous Adršpach-Teplice Rocks, naturally i was climbing since I was 10. My skills and love for the rocks and mountains grew over time and I was able to take on more and more difficult routes up to 8 UIAA with some  first ascent in records. Grossglockner, the highest mountain of Austrian Alps was a dream come true. Months of physical and mental preparation and finally the day of the ascent has come. We had a perfect weather just for that one day and managed to reach the top. It was on the way down in the middle of the route when some 100 meters from us a huge rock with size of London’s doubledecker loosen itself from the massif and was rushing downhill just in our path where we would be on our descent in 15 minutes. That night I had to think why so many people including myself are willing to risk their lives only to climb a mountain. My conclusion is that being so near the possibility of death gives one feeling being alive absolutely. I realized there is a better and no less challenging way to feel the life. Be a personality true to oneself. I have never went on climbing since.
